diff options
-rwxr-xr-x | org.eclipse.egit.github.core.tests/src/org/eclipse/egit/github/core/tests/PullRequestTest.java | 2 | ||||
-rw-r--r-- | org.eclipse.egit.github.core/src/org/eclipse/egit/github/core/PullRequest.java | 18 |
2 files changed, 20 insertions, 0 deletions
diff --git a/org.eclipse.egit.github.core.tests/src/org/eclipse/egit/github/core/tests/PullRequestTest.java b/org.eclipse.egit.github.core.tests/src/org/eclipse/egit/github/core/tests/PullRequestTest.java index 3ba15f01..9903f779 100755 --- a/org.eclipse.egit.github.core.tests/src/org/eclipse/egit/github/core/tests/PullRequestTest.java +++ b/org.eclipse.egit.github.core.tests/src/org/eclipse/egit/github/core/tests/PullRequestTest.java @@ -61,6 +61,7 @@ public class PullRequestTest { assertNull(request.getUrl());
assertNull(request.getUser());
assertNotNull(request.toString());
+ assertEquals(0, request.getId());
}
/**
@@ -105,6 +106,7 @@ public class PullRequestTest { assertEquals("/url", request.setUrl("/url").getUrl());
User user = new User().setLogin("cuser");
assertEquals(user, request.setUser(user).getUser());
+ assertEquals(70, request.setId(70).getId());
}
/**
diff --git a/org.eclipse.egit.github.core/src/org/eclipse/egit/github/core/PullRequest.java b/org.eclipse.egit.github.core/src/org/eclipse/egit/github/core/PullRequest.java index 558c74f0..b262ae74 100644 --- a/org.eclipse.egit.github.core/src/org/eclipse/egit/github/core/PullRequest.java +++ b/org.eclipse.egit.github.core/src/org/eclipse/egit/github/core/PullRequest.java @@ -35,6 +35,8 @@ public class PullRequest implements Serializable { private Date createdAt; + private long id; + private int additions; private int changedFiles; @@ -491,6 +493,22 @@ public class PullRequest implements Serializable { return this; } + /** + * @return id + */ + public long getId() { + return id; + } + + /** + * @param id + * @return this pull request + */ + public PullRequest setId(long id) { + this.id = id; + return this; + } + @Override public String toString() { return "Pull Request " + number; //$NON-NLS-1$ |